Skip to content

Commit 37e03e3

Browse files
committed
Don't update req_bytes_received if no bytes were received.
1 parent 456b73d commit 37e03e3

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

ompi/mca/pml/ob1/pml_ob1_recvreq.c

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-818,8 +818,8 @@ void mca_pml_ob1_recv_request_progress_rndv( mca_pml_ob1_recv_request_t* recvreq
818818
recvreq->req_recv.req_base.req_count,
819819
recvreq->req_recv.req_base.req_datatype);
820820
);
821+
OPAL_THREAD_ADD_SIZE_T(&recvreq->req_bytes_received, bytes_received);
821822
}
822-
OPAL_THREAD_ADD_SIZE_T(&recvreq->req_bytes_received, bytes_received);
823823
/* check completion status */
824824
if(recv_request_pml_complete_check(recvreq) == false &&
825825
recvreq->req_rdma_offset < recvreq->req_send_offset) {

0 commit comments

Comments
 (0)